自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 Mybatis之动态sql(以及#和$的区别)

#{}是将括号中的变量之前是什么类型传过来还是什么类型,然而 ${} 是将括号中的变量传过来都是字符串类型(不管之前什么类型)用于查询操作的标签where标签类似于where 1= 1的作用第一个满足的if 会自动将 and去掉<select id="getUserByIf" resultType="com.zcc.mybatis.user.entity.UserInfo"&gt...

2020-02-20 20:54:07 638

原创 Mybatis 之Mapper(映射)

当两个数据库表一块获取数据的时候可以分为一对一的关系和一对多的关系当为一对多的关系时候 sql的xml文件如下<mapper namespace="com.zcc.mybatis.user.dao.userDao"><resultMap type="com.zcc.mybatis.user.entity.UserInfo" id="userInfo"> &l...

2020-02-15 17:35:53 252

原创 MySQL数据库的使用

2020-02-15 14:48:24 119

原创 Mybatis (一)初识Mybatis以及Mybatis全局配置

Mybatis什么是Mybatis?MyBatis源自Apache的iBatis开源项目, 从iBatis3.x开始正式更名为MyBatis。它是一个优秀的持久层框架。官网地址:http://www.mybatis.org/mybatis-3/为什么使用MyBatis? 降低耦合度为了和数据库进行交互,通常的做法是将SQL语句写在Java代码中,SQL语句和Java代码耦合在一起...

2020-02-13 21:27:45 155

原创 SpringMvc之异常处理

异常处理在使用@ExceptionHandler进行异常处理时,不可以将exception直接设置到方法参数中声明的modle, 必须返回ModelAndView@ExceptionHandler public ModelAndView handleException(IndexOutOfBoundsException e) { ModelAndView mav = new Mode...

2020-02-10 23:10:52 136

原创 Lombok之@Data注解

在定义类的上方加上@Data注解可以直接使用这个类的get.set方法不用再去写lombok里面的注解要使用lombok的注解 首先要在引入jar包 也就是在maven项目的pom文件里面配置上对应的代码 在网上搜索maven 然后搜索lombok<!-- https://mvnrepository.com/artifact/org.projectlombok/lombo...

2020-02-09 21:00:17 449

原创 Mybatis(面试问题)

1、什么是 MyBatis?答:MyBatis 是一个可以自定义 SQL、存储过程和高级映射的持久层框架。2、讲下 MyBatis 的缓存答:MyBatis 的缓存分为一级缓存和二级缓存,一级缓存放在 session 里面,默认就有,二级缓存放在它的命名空间里,默认是不打开的,使用二级缓存属性类需要实现 Serializable 序列化接口(可用来保存对象的状态),可在它的映射文件中配置...

2020-02-09 16:20:07 243

原创 BootStrap

bootStrap学习网址 https://blog.csdn.net/weixin_43214978/article/details/98887260

2020-02-09 15:44:48 85

原创 Spring Mvc 之 拦截器

Spring Mvc也可以通过拦截器对请求进行拦截。用户可以自定义拦截器来实现特定的功能,自定义的拦截器必须实现HandlerInterceptor接口(该接口里面的方法都是default 需要自己去写那三个方法)preHandle方法会在handler方法执行之前拦截用户的请求,如果return 的是false,则表示中断操作,后面也不会再进行,return true 则会继续往后面执行...

2020-02-08 17:13:30 116

原创 用Postman模拟http请求获取数据和发送数据

在网页开发中,有时候你需要去获取别人项目中的数据,需要模拟http请求去获取数据和提交数据(需要对象开放端口并且告诉你)。并且获取到的数据要转化为json格式 在提交数据的时候 你需要知道你想要获取的对象的准确名字也可以通过postman这个工具去发送数据通过json传输的时候 data类型是不可以用的...

2020-02-08 16:06:08 3036 2

原创 Spring-mvc 之json对象与java对象

在开发网页得时候,我们可以通过将数据库中的一条信息映射到一个java类的一个对象来获取我们数据库中的内容,但是别人如果想获取我们的数据 他们并不知道里面是什么格式,所有在获取的时候可以通过json对象获取数据,获取出来的是一个json字符串在之前我们用http返回json对象的时候Gson类里面的toJson()方法可以将一个java’对象转化成一个json对象public void ...

2020-02-06 19:35:39 144

原创 Spring-Mvc之 文件上传

我们在Web的开发过程中肯定要用到文件的传输之前我们用过http的文件传输可以参考之前的文章https://blog.csdn.net/qq_15740137/article/details/102573682https://blog.csdn.net/qq_15740137/article/details/102759665Mvc给我们提供了更见方便的文件上传在运用mvc的传输...

2020-02-05 23:48:36 86

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除